Highlights
- Houston spends 48.2% less per student than Trenton.
- The Student Teacher Ratio is 28.0% higher in Houston than in Trenton. (lower means fewer students in each classroom).
- Houston had 5.2% more residents who had graduated High School compared to Trenton
